About

Dr. Irene Paraboschi is a pioneering pediatric surgeon whose research is reshaping the landscape of minimally invasive surgery for children, with a particular focus on robotic-assisted techniques and urological reconstruction. Her work centers on demonstrating the safety, efficacy, and learning curves associated with robotic surgery in vulnerable pediatric populations. Notably, her systematic review on the "Learning curve for robotic surgery in children" (33 citations) has become a foundational reference for training programs, while her multi-institutional European study comparing robotic-assisted versus open ureteral reimplantation for high-grade vesicoureteral reflux (30 citations) provides critical evidence supporting the adoption of robotic approaches. Dr. Paraboschi also pushes the boundaries of innovation, exploring the integration of 3D modeling and augmented reality in pediatric cancer surgery (25 citations), and has performed pioneering work in robotic-assisted total esophagogastric dissociation for children with severe neurodisability (11 citations). Her contributions are not only advancing surgical precision but also establishing the benchmarks for training the next generation of pediatric surgeons, making her a leading voice in the evolution of pediatric robotic surgery.
